While current research suggests that
most people with
celiac disease are not sensitive to the protein in oats, the grain can be contaminated with wheat since oat and wheat fields tend to be in close proximity.

The issue for the
celiac consumer is that consuming gluten free oats that have not been tested in this manner would result in
most servings being fine but then they would consume a kernel contaminated serving which would be several times over the FDA limit.

Dr Jason Tye - Din, head of
celiac research at the Walter and Eliza Hall Institute and a gastroenterologist at The Royal Melbourne Hospital, said the study showed oats were well tolerated by
most people with
celiac disease, but in a proportion of people with
celiac disease oat consumption could trigger immune responses similar to those caused by eating barley.
